CHICAGO – The Chicago Union is gearing up for an exciting 2025 season, building on a strong foundation of success. Since 2021, the Union have won 70% of their games, a testament to their consistent performance in the Ultimate Frisbee Association (UFA). The Union is poised to make waves this year with a growing fanbase and increasing visibility.

Adding to the excitement, Chicago has made key international signings, including 2024 European Player of the Year Daan de Marrée and European Club Champion Sofiène Bontemps. The team will be led by co-head coaches Dave Woods and Charlie Furse, ensuring a strong leadership presence throughout the season. Fans can watch live games on WatchUFA.tv, with replays available on Marquee Sports Network, which also broadcasts Chicago Cubs games.

May 17th, 2025 | 6 P.M. | AWAY @ Minnesota Wind Chill

We kick off our season on the road against the defending UFA champions, Minnesota Wind Chill, in a highly anticipated rematch. Last year, in the Union's season opener, we had a season-low 33% huck percentage. The UFA defines a huck as 40+ yards play. So it will be fascinating to see how many big plays we can convert this match. The Wind Chill won the 2024 season series 2-1, with both teams winning on the road, making this a prime opportunity for Chicago to set the tone for the season.

May 31st, 2025 | 6 P.M. | HOME vs. Atlanta Hustle @ De La Salle Institute

The first-ever “Chicago Classic" occurs at De La Salle Institute, where the Union played their home games for the 2022 and 2023 seasons. Atlanta enters the season with one of the most demanding schedules in the UFA, making this non-divisional clash a valuable test for both teams. The Hustle finished 2024 with a strong 10-3 record and has consistently been among the league's top contenders.

June 8th, 2025 | 5 P.M. | HOME vs. Madison Radicals @ Northwestern Medicine Field at Martin Stadium

The Union's first home game at Northwestern Medicine Field at Martin Stadium ​in 2025 will be a heated divisional matchup against longtime rivals, the Madison Radicals. Last season, Chicago edged Madison at home in a thrilling 20-19 contest after trailing 10-11 at halftime. The Radicals, who will host the UFA Championship Weekend at Breese Stevens Field later this year, are always a tough matchup, making this an early-season game with significant playoff implications.

June 14th, 2025 | 6 P.M. | AWAY @ Indianapolis AlleyCats

The team will then travel to Indianapolis to face the AlleyCats. The Union split their two games 1-1 with the AlleyCats in 2024, losing a nail-biter 20-21 on the road but winning a 19-14 victory at home. If the Union can replicate their 97% completion percentage from last season's matchup against the AlleyCats, they have a strong chance for an away win. 

June 20th, 2025 | 6 P.M. | HOME vs. Pittsburgh Thunderbirds @ Northwestern Medicine Field at Martin Stadium

Pittsburgh struggled to a 4-8 record last season but managed to upset the Union once in 2024. The Union had a season-low 87% completion percentage in their matchup against the Thunderbirds, so they must stay disciplined to secure the win at home.

June 28th, 2025 | 6 P.M. | AWAY @ Detroit Mechanix

The Union will face off against Detroit, a team they dominated in 2024 with a 24-14 home victory. This game presents another opportunity for Chicago to assert itself in the Central Division.

July 4th, 2025 | 4 P.M. | HOME vs. Minnesota Wind Chill @ Northwestern Medicine Field at Martin Stadium

One of the biggest home games of the season, this matchup follows Evanston's July 4th parade and is expected to bring a packed, high-energy crowd. Last year, the Wind Chill narrowly edged the Union in Chicago with a 17-16 victory. If Chicago can convert at a high clip in the red zone, just like their matchups against the Wind Chill, they will be in a prime position for revenge in front of their home fans.

July 5th, 2025 | 7 P.M. | AWAY @ Pittsburgh Thunderbirds

It is a quick turnaround for Chicago as they travel to Pittsburgh for their second matchup against the Thunderbirds. With Union playing the night before, depth and endurance will be key factors in this showdown.

July 19th, 2025 | 6 P.M. | HOME vs. Detroit Mechanix @ Northwestern Medicine Field at Martin Stadium

In the regular season final home game, the Union will have a chance to solidify their postseason positioning. Last year, the Union closed out their regular season at home by defeating Detroit 24-14. Fans can expect an electric atmosphere as the Union looks to close out their home schedule on a strong note.

July 20th, 2025 | 5 P.M. | AWAY @ Madison Radicals

It is a critical matchup to end the regular season, with potential playoff seeding on the line. Facing Madison on the road is never easy. Last season, the Union struggled in Madison, suffering a tough 13-21 loss during the regular season. Then, in the playoffs Madison defeated the Union at Breese Stevens 17-18 to advance in the playoffs. 

With Madison set to host the UFA Championship, this game could impact potential playoff positioning heading into the postseason. Championship Weekend is set for August 22-23. Both semifinal games will be held on Friday, August 22, with the first one at 5 p.m. and the latter at 7 p.m. The 2025 UFA Championship Game is set for Saturday, August 23, in primetime at 7 p.m.
